Mothers of minors at scene of Longueuil teen's shooting file $1.9M lawsuit against city, police
A civil lawsuit of nearly $1.9 million was filed Thursday against the City of Longueuil and several of its police officers, after an intervention in September 2025 in which police fatally shot a teenage boy.

If you don't know the saga of #Afroman I suggest you settle in on YouTube for some fun history videos. The Cincinnati area rapper filled his home with security cameras. When he was wrongfully raided because of a bad warrant he used the footage to make some hilarious music videos, with topics such as the police officer that seems to want to raid Afroman's fridge. Not that "Will You Help Me Repair My Door?" isn't a banger, but the surveillance footage really makes these videos what they are. Of course, the cops had nothing to charge him with and are now pissed that he embarrassed them. 

I've read the warrant, by the way. The cops found out he used to rap a song about the evils of drug abuse so they gambled that he'd be in that industry. The warrant was lies, specualtion, and a bad faith fishing expedition.

Exclusive: #DOJ unit on #PoliceMisconduct sees staffing plunge & probes scaled back

The #US Justice Department unit responsible for prosecuting potential wrongdoing by law enforcement, including during the crackdown on illegal #immigration in #Minneapolis, has lost TWO-THIRDS of its #prosecutors & is under orders to scale back its investigations of #ExcessiveForce….
